Dirty Desk is a curated catalog — less a database, more a rummage through a very well-kept desk. Everything here is hand-picked and catalogued one piece at a time; nothing is dumped in by the crateload. You don't so much search as wander, and end up somewhere you didn't plan.
The rule is simple: only the things worth keeping. We start with art — paintings and prints drawn from open museum collections — and add what earns a spot on the desk beside it.
